Liberty Common School is a Poudre School District charter school dedicated to Core Knowledge principles and character education. The school currently enrolls over 590 students grades k-6.
Liberty Common School provides excellence and fairness in education by teaching a contextual body of organized knowledge, the skills of learning, and the values of a democratic society. This is done through parental choice, partnership with teachers, and student acceptance of responsibility for his/her academic effort.
The Teachers’ Aide plays an important role at Liberty Common, supporting and supplementing delivery of the educational program in individual classrooms. The Aide works closely with the teachers to effectively integrate subjects and methods with the teachers' overall instructional plans. The Aide may supplement the educational program by delivering specialized skills and knowledge to the students.

Minimum Essential Duties:
- Research and gather resources and materials needed for lesson units
- Set up classroom materials and equipment
- Coordinate classroom volunteer activities
- Assist in monitoring and supporting students during lunches and recesses
- Enforce administration policies and rules governing students
- Conduct testing and evaluate student work as directed by teachers
- Conduct student interventions
- Monitor, assess, and report on students’ progress
- Communicate clearly and respectfully with teachers, other faculty, students, and parents
- Tutor and assist children individually or in small groups to help them master assignments and to reinforce learning concepts presented by teachers.
- Assist in maintaining inventories of materials, equipment, or products
- Adapt communication and teaching styles when necessary to support individual students and their families
